Pernem railway station (Station code: PERN) is a railway station in North Goa district of Goa state.[1]
It is part of the Konkan Railway, in the town of Pernem in the North Goa district of Goa State and is under Karwar railway division of Konkan Railway zone, a subsidiary zone of Indian Railways.[2]
History
The 5,002 feet (1,525 m) Pernem Tunnel on the line was begun in 1992, but had a lengthy history of repeated tunnel collapses that held up completion of the entire line through Pernem until 1998. The chief engineer of the tunnel construction was later to characterize it as "a job from hell", with repeated floods caused by monsoon weather that could wash away months of work in a matter of hours. Nine workers died during the Pernem Tunnel construction alone, out of the 74 deaths across the entire Konkan Railway project.
A 5 metres (16 ft) section of the tunnel collapsed again in August 2020, and required 40 days work to restore service, reinforcing the tunnel with steel plates; all of which had to be done during the lockdown restrictions imposed to counter the COVID-19 pandemic in India.
Structure
It is located at 18 metres (59 ft) above sea level and has two platforms. As of 2016, a single broad-gauge railway line exists at this station, and 14 trains stop at Pernem. The Goa Airport situated at Dabolim is at distance of 38 kilometres (24 mi) from this railway station.[7]
